Ace Frehley is beginning the new year by looking back. The former Kiss guitarist’s new LP, Origins Vol. 1 – due out April 15th – finds him covering songs by Jimi Hendrix, the Rolling Stones, Thin Lizzy and other artists that have inspired him over the years. His heavy-hitting take on Cream’s “White Room” is premiering here. The LP also features his first recording with Paul Stanley, an impassioned interpretation of Free’s “Fire and Water,” in nearly two decades. Other guests on the record include Slash, Pearl Jam’s Mike McCready, Lita Ford and Rob Zombie guitarist John 5.
“I’m really thrilled with the whole thing,” Frehley tells Rolling Stone. “I’m excited about it, and probably somewhere down the road there’ll be a second volume.”
Origins Vol. 1 Track List

1. “White Room” (Cream)
2. “Street Fighting Man” (Rolling Stones)
3. “Spanish Castle Magic,” feat. John 5 (Jimi Hendrix)
4. “Fire and Water,” feat. Paul Stanley (Free)
5. “Emerald,” Slash (Thin Lizzy)
6. “Bring It on Home” (Led Zeppelin)
7. “Wild Thing,” feat. Lita Ford (The Troggs)
8. “Parasite,” feat. John 5 (Kiss)
9. “Magic Carpet Ride” (Steppenwolf)
10. “Cold Gin,” feat. Mike McCready (Kiss)
11. “Till the End of the Day” (Kinks)
12. “Rock and Roll Hell” (Kiss)
